About General Consulate of Colombia in San Juan, Puerto Rico
Established to serve the diverse needs of the Colombian community and international visitors in San Juan, PR, the General Consulate of Colombia represents the commitment of the Colombian government to protect, inform, and advocate for its citizens living abroad. This diplomatic office embodies Colombia's dedication to fostering positive relationships with residents throughout the Caribbean region, including Puerto Rico, the Virgin Islands, and neighboring territories. The consulate's mission extends beyond administrative processing—it serves as a vital bridge connecting Colombian nationals with their homeland, ensuring they receive proper guidance, support, and access to governmental resources regardless of their circumstances.
